Dynamo Moscow will extend the contract with hockey player Nikita Gusev – club

Dynamo Moscow striker Nikita Gusev will sign a new contract, said the president of the hockey club, Viktor Voronin.

During the KHL regular season, Gusev set a league record for the number of points – 89 (23 goals + 66 assists) in 68 matches. The 31-year-old striker also has 10 points (3+7) in nine Gagarin Cup matches. Behind “Dynamo” Gusev has been performing since 2023.

“Before the start of the playoffs, a decision was made to extend the contract until April 30, 2024,” reports a correspondent, according to Voronin’s words.

Earlier, reported that Gusev’s representatives were asking Dynamo for a contract with conditions comparable to the deal for Avangard striker Vladimir Tkachev. The Dynamo striker could receive a salary of more than 100 million rubles next season, excluding individual bonuses, which amounted to around 30 million rubles for the 2023/24 season.

At the end of the KHL regular season, Dynamo takes first place and wins the Continental Cup. At the Gagarin Cup, the “blue and white” reached the second round and lost to Traktor with a score of 0-4 in the series.
